Traçabilité des mesures des paramètres S aux fréquences intermediaries (100 kHz – 100 MHz)
Laboratoire National de Métrologie et d’Essais, 29 avenue Roger Hennequin, 78197 Trappes, France
a Corresponding author: francois.ziade@lne.fr
Abstract
At LNE, a new 50 Ω primary standard with a female type N connector (7 mm) was just developed for providing one-port traceable S-parameters measurements in this frequency range [1]. The typical expanded uncertainties (k = 2) are in the range 1.10-3 to 4.10-3 and in the range 2,5.10-3 to 1.10-2 for reflection coefficient values close to 0 and above 1.10-2 respectively. To complete the LNE measurement capabilities, a 50 Ω load with a male type N connector is currently being developed which will be establish the traceability of two-ports S-parameters measurements. The development of the 50 Ω load with a male type N connector is presented in this paper.
